Biography

Congfang Huang is a lecturer at the Edwardson School of Industrial Engineering at Purdue University. He has a strong academic background with multiple degrees from the University of Wisconsin-Madison, where he obtained a Ph.D. in Industrial Systems Engineering with a minor in Statistics, as well as a Master of Science in Statistics and another in Computer Sciences. Additionally, he holds a Master of Arts in Applied Mathematics and a Bachelor's degree in Applied Mathematics from Sun Yat-sen University in China. His research interests lie at the intersection of industrial engineering and statistics, focusing on developing innovative solutions to complex engineering problems through quantitative techniques.
